School Description
School Summary and Highlights
- Enrolls 270 elementary school students from grades KG-4
- Ranks 1095th out of 2,535 elementary schools in NY.
Additional Contact Information
- Principal or Admin: James Martino
School Operational Details
- Title I Eligible
School District Details
- Coxsackie-Athens Central School District
- Per-Pupil Spending: $13,868
- Graduation Rate: 70.5%
- Dropout Rate: 4.7%
- Students Per Teacher: 11.9
- Enrolled Students: 1,542
Faculty Details and Student Enrollment
Students and Faculty
- Total Students Enrolled: 270
- Total Full Time "Equivalent" Teachers: 22.0
- Average Student-To-Teacher Ratio: 12.3
Students Gender Breakdown
- Males: 151 (55.9%)
- Females: 119 (44.1%)
Free Lunch Student Eligibility Breakdown
- Eligible for Reduced Lunch: 27 (10.0%)
- Eligible for Free Lunch: 75 (27.8%)
- Eligible for Either Reduced or Free Lunch: 102 (37.8%)
